What You Should Know About wood Burning Fireplace Inserts

24 Nov 2011

If you are building a fireplace in your home, there are a lot of things that you will need to work on. First, you should check to see whether your building's code permits you to build a fireplace. If you have an apartment, for example, it might be a better idea to use an electric fireplace than to have wood burning fireplace inserts set up in there. On the other hand, if you are convinced that you have enough space to build your own fireplace, then you can start the process comfortably knowing that before long you will be able to enjoy the advantages of a warm fire burning in the corner.

Of course, when it comes to building the fireplace itself you can either choose to have a professional build it for you or do it all on your own. There are numerous advantages to hiring a professional, but if you feel like you can do it yourself then you should be prepared to put it some research. It can take time to build a fireplace, but it is certainly not something that is too difficult for you to do on your own.
